## Runbook: Addresskit Widget Degradation

When the Fenwright address autocomplete widget returns empty suggestions, first check the upstream geodata feed health panel. If the feed is green, restart the suggestion workers one at a time; draining takes about two minutes each. Escalate to the platform rotation if latency stays above 600ms after restart. Before restarting, confirm the workers are running with the expected configuration, listed here.

deployment values, yadug-bawif:
[framir]
team = pelox
access_code = ac_a38ab2
owner = tamion.julael
host = framir.tolvaqlabs.test
port = 11211
peer = tammir.zemvargrid.local
salt = 2215ef03
pin = 1541

- [ ] Key ceremony, step 7: Before signing the release build of the Vexhall elevator-dispatch simulator, confirm both custodians are present and the ceremony laptop has remained offline since imaging. New team members should watch rather than type during their first ceremony. Verify the simulator's scenario bundle hash against the printed manifest. Once verified, unseal the signing token using the recovery passphrase recorded just below this item.

vault phrase of bafop-bagep = holael-quenwyn

## Hot reload

Cranewire reloads config on SIGHUP. Do not restart the process; in-flight requests will drop. Edit the file, validate with the lint tool, then send the signal. Check the reload counter in the health endpoint afterward. If the counter didn't increment, the file failed validation. The reloadable keys and their current values are:

settings of fafog-haduf:
ZORIX_PIN=4648
ZORIX_METRICS_HOST=metrics.zorix.paliqsys.corp
ZORIX_LOG_LEVEL=info
ZORIX_TENANT=druix

Subject: Eventforge schema registry — v2 is live

Hey plugin folks — the Eventforge registry now enforces compatibility checks on upload, so if your event schema drops a required field, the push gets bounced instead of silently breaking downstream consumers. Good news: draft schemas get a sandbox namespace, so experiment freely there. Please re-register anything you published before last Tuesday, since old entries lack compat metadata. The registry build serving all this is identified right below.

pipeline stamp: htk31_f769b577b3028a4e9958e5bb8d1259a